Job Title: HGV Technician / HGV Mechanic / HGV Fitter

Salary: £20 per hour DOE

Shift: Various Shifts Available

Type: Permanent

Location: Wellingborough

We are looking for a HGV Technician / HGV Mechanic / HGV Fitter to join our client, one of the UK's leading manufacturers.

Job Responsibilities:
  • Fast and accurate diagnoses using diagnostic tools and choosing the right repair techniques.
  • Work independently to maintain and repair vehicles and components.
  • Carry out a range of inspections (MOT, tacho, etc.).
  • Provide support and daily mentoring for less experienced technicians.
  • Carry out final checks on work that has been completed.
Qualifications and Requirements:
  • Time-served HGV Technician or equivalent qualification (City & Guilds / NVQ Level 3 preferred)
  • Strong diagnostic and fault-finding skills
  • Extensive experience in carrying out repairs and maintenance on trucks, components and associated vehicles.
  • Familiarity with developments in the automotive industry.
  • Valid Driving License
